WebMar 4, 2024 · When you cook potatoes, the original starches lose their structure in the process but once the taters are cooled, a new structure … Web2. Serve safely. If cooked potatoes are being reheated, make sure they reach at least 165°F. If the potatoes are being used in a ready-to-eat cold dish, like a potato salad, make sure the dish is served below 41°F. Resistant starch: How to turn potatoes and rice into health foods

WebJul 3, 2024 · Type 2: Is found in some starchy foods, including raw potatoes and green (unripe) bananas. Type 3: Is formed when certain starchy foods, including potatoes and rice, are cooked and then cooled. WebMay 6, 2016 · It just makes it a little less glycemic and feeds your gut bugs. It’s a “lower” carb way to eat potatoes. You can get away with more of them. A new study examined the effects of cooking and cooling a dozen or so varieties of potato. Estimated glycemic response was reduced by 10-15% across the board after cooling the cooked potatoes.
